March 2026. Yunting Xie, Fredrik Tell, Matti La Mela and Shigehiro Nishimura presented papers at the BHC in London in two panels.


Session 1h: Innovation in Peripheral Economies in the Long 20th Century City and Guilds LT664

Chair: Bernardita Escobar Andrae, University of Valparaiso

Veronique Pouillard, University of Oslo" Analyzing Innovation through a Historical Patent Database: The Case of the Colonial Congo Patent System (1888-Early 1960s)" 

Matti La Mela, University of Uppsala "Co-creation through Patent Disclosure: French Patents in Sweden, 1885–1914" 

Martin Monsalve, University of the Pacific "Engineers, Expertise, and Innovation: The Dual Role of Peruvian Technocrats in Patent System Formation (1893–1930)" 

 

Session 3k: Innovation through Co-creation City and Guilds 747/748

Chair: John Cantwell, Rutgers University

Discussant: Chris Colvin, Queen's University Belfast

Shigehiro Nishimura, Kobe University and Yunting Xie, Uppsala University and Fredrik Tell, Uppsala University "Gadelius and Swedish Business in Japan: Co-creating Global Business as a Patent Agent " 

Bernardita Escobar Andrae, University of Valparaiso "The Business Cycle of Innovators: A Tale from the Chilean Patent System, 1877-1910" 

Marco Martinez, University of Pisa and Valeria Pinchera, University of Pisa" Trademarking Innovation: Exploring the Role of Intellectual Property in Italy's Fashion industry, 1861–1939"
